Explore the Wonders of Albania

Albania, a country nestled on the Adriatic and Ionian Seas, is a treasure trove of natural beauty and cultural heritage. It boasts pristine beaches, rugged mountains, and a rich tapestry of history that dates back to ancient times. Visitors can explore the ancient ruins of Butrint, a UNESCO World Heritage site, or relax on the beautiful beaches of the Albanian Riviera. The capital city, Tirana, offers a vibrant mix of modernity and tradition with its colorful architecture and lively atmosphere. Whether you are trekking in the Albanian Alps or enjoying the hospitality of its people, Albania promises an unforgettable adventure.

Berat

Known as the 'City of a Thousand Windows,' Berat is famous for its well-preserved Ottoman architecture and stunning hilltop castle. It's a UNESCO World Heritage site that offers a glimpse into Albania's rich cultural heritage.

Durrës

Durrës is one of the oldest cities in Albania, known for its rich history, beautiful beaches, and vibrant port. It offers a mix of culture, history, and relaxation, making it a popular destination for both locals and tourists.

Gjirokastër

Gjirokastër, another UNESCO World Heritage site, is known for its distinct stone architecture and historical significance. The city is characterized by its Ottoman-era houses and the impressive Gjirokastër Castle overlooking the valley.

Tirana

Tirana, the capital city of Albania, is a vibrant and bustling metropolis known for its colorful buildings, rich culture, and lively atmosphere. It serves as the political and economic center of the country, offering a mix of Ottoman, Italian, and communist-era architecture.
